Titapani - Kalgachia, Barpeta
Titapani is a village situated in the Kalgachia subdivision of Barpeta district, Assam. Titapani village is a designated Gaon Panchayat.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Titapani is 282732. The village covers a total geographical area of 287.94 hectares and falls under the 781319 pincode. Sorbhog is the nearest town, located about 26 km away.
Titapani village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a President ser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Jania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Dhubri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.
Population of Titapani
According to the 2011 Census, Titapani village had a total population of 3,380 people, including 1,749 males and 1,631 females, living in 617 households. The sex ratio was 933 females per 1,000 males. The overall literacy rate was 62.04%, with male literacy at 66.47% and female literacy at 57.15%. The Scheduled Caste (SC) population was 30.

Transport and Connectivity of Titapani
Public transport facilities are available within <1 km of the Titapani. The nearest railway station is located within >10 km of Titapani.
| Connectivity |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Public Bus Service | Yes | Available within village |
| Private Bus Service | Yes | Available within village |
| Railway Station | No | Available within >10 km |
In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. The road distance from Sorbhog to Titapani is about 26 km, with a usual travel time of around 1-1.25 hours. Similarly, the road distance from Barpeta to Titapani is about 40 km, with the usual travel time around 1-1.25 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
